As the sun sets on Malawi’s historic 2025 general election day, polling stations across the nation are wrapping up—official closing time is 4PM local.
From bustling queues in Lilongwe to vibrant vibes in Blantyre, as at 3pm the Malawi Electoral Commission said only 3 million of the 7 million registered voters had spoken on the presidency, parliament, and local councils. Counting kicks off immediately.
